International Association of Machinists v. Air Canada

International Association of Machinists v. Air Canada

The application was dismissed for mootness because any determination of the Board's jurisdiction would be limited to the highly unusual facts of the case and would have little precedential value.

  1. 1 Whether the Canada Industrial Relations Board had jurisdiction in the matter
  2. 2 Whether the application for judicial review was moot and should be dismissed

Ratio Decidendi

The application was dismissed for mootness because any determination of the Board's jurisdiction would be limited to the highly unusual facts of the case and would have little precedential value.

Court Disposition

Application dismissed

Orders

  • Application for judicial review dismissed with costs.
